On Thu, Apr 18, 2002 at 10:27:34AM +0200, Daniel de Rauglaudre w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> On Thu, Apr 18, 2002 at 10:02:42AM +0200, Jérôme Marant wrote:
> 
> >   By the way, in order to improve the localization process, we would need
> >   to add the "argument reordering" feature to printf functions.
> >   For instance, with: 
> > 
> >   printf " %2$d %1$s" "foo" 1
> 
> I have something like that, indeed. It is also John Prevost's remark.
> For that I use the same system of lexicon, but I don't use printf, but
> just print_string for this kind of phrases.

  So, if I understood correctly, the string parameters are nothing but
  strings, right?

...

> Of course, in all these examples, printf does not work: you have to
> apply print_string, or printf "%s"

  I'ld love to see the feature in printf though.
